Architecture of Observation Towers

It seems to be human nature to enjoy a view, getting the higher ground and taking in our surroundings has become a significant aspect of architecture across the world. Observation towers which allow visitors to climb and observe their surroundings, provide a chance to take in the beauty of the land while at the same time adding something unique and impressive to the landscape.

What is a Mental Health Assessment?

Your doctor can use an assessment of your mental health to determine how well you deal with your feelings and behavior. It involves a physical exam and your doctor will ask you questions about your feelings. The doctor will also look at how you think and remember (cognitive function). Your doctor may request that you keep a journal or a diary for a few weeks and send them an account.

You may be uncomfortable during the mental health evaluation. It involves a discussion of very personal topics and can cause negative emotions. Be aware that an assessment is necessary to determine the severity of your condition and receive the appropriate treatment.

There are a myriad of types of psychiatric disorders, such as mood disorders, such as depression and bipolar disorder; anxiety disorders, including anxiety and panic; eating disorders, such as anorexia and bulimia; as well as attention deficit hyperactivity disorder (ADHD). Your psychiatrist will examine your symptoms and background to determine what kind of psychiatric disorder you have and what treatment would be most beneficial for you.

Your doctor may also order tests for labs, like urine or blood tests. These tests will help your doctor find out whether you have any medical condition that could be contributing to your symptoms, for example, thyroid disease or poisoning.

One of the most important components of the mental health assessment is the mental health exam (MSE). It is a systematic method of observing the current mental state. It includes appearance as well as attitude and behavior, speech, thought processes, thought content, memory and perception, insight and judgment.

The MSE lets doctors spot symptoms of mental illness and measure the effectiveness of treatment. The MSE is also a great instrument to measure the quality of treatment provided by mental health services. For instance, it can be used to assess the amount of patients discharged from a mental health service with an explanation of how their symptoms have been improved or worsened.

How is a mental evaluation carried out?

A mental health evaluation will typically include a variety of activities, such as interviews, physical tests and filling out an assessment questionnaire. The psychiatrist conducting the assessment will also ask you a lot of questions, about your symptoms and about your personal history. They'll also want to know about any other physical ailments that you're experiencing, as they may mimic the symptoms of mental illness. The physical exam could be a simple one, but they may also need to collect urine or blood samples, or order tests like an EEG or CT scan.

During the interview part of a mental health assessment you'll be asked a lot of different questions regarding how you've been feeling and what your thoughts have been lately. They'll also be looking for any changes in your mood as well as how you've behaved in your work, family, or social life. The professional in mental health is also taking notes on how you feel and what you are experiencing right now.

They'll also ask you lots of questions regarding the medications you're currently taking, both prescription and over-the-counter medications as well as any supplements you're taking or herbal remedies. If you've had any previous mental illnesses, they'll need to know about those as well.

The psychiatrist will also want to know about any issues that you've experienced in your work, family or Mental health diagnosis assessment relationships. They will want to know about your coping mechanisms and if you've considered self-harm or suicide.

If your psychiatrist believes that you pose a threat to yourself or others, he may decide that you should be separated. They will arrange for you be transported to an NHS psychiatric facility where they can help with your mental health issues. They'll also be able to prescribe any medication that you might need. This is a major decision that's only made in extreme situations. If you think that your psychiatrist or GP is considering this, then you should consult with an advocate from Rethink to discuss the issue and get suggestions.

What is the cost for an assessment of mental health?

If you're thinking about an assessment for mental health, it's worth remembering that the cost of an evaluation may be less than you might think. Your insurance coverage could help offset costs depending on the clinic and kind of test you select. In addition, some psychologists offer sliding scales for those without insurance and might be able to work with you to set up a payment plan.

In general, the average cost of a psychiatrist visit will run you somewhere around $100-$200 per session. The cost of a visit to a psychiatrist can vary depending on factors such as the location, experience, expertise in specialization, and the demand. Certain psychiatrists are more expensive than others. Be sure to look at prices before selecting a psychiatrist.

It is also important to keep in mind that a mental exam is often seen as an initial step in treatment, and could require additional appointments. The cost of an assessment will vary depending on your symptoms and the length of the time that you have to visit a doctor.

Medical doctors, may recommend that certain tests in the lab or physical exams be carried out. These tests can be expensive costs, in addition to the psychiatric evaluation. If you require medication, the psychiatrist will prescribe it once they have confirmed the diagnosis. The dosage and specific medication will depend on the condition of your patient.
